I beg to differ... up until January 2006, misticaudio used the same manufacturer as Noreve. The black cases are not hand cut. The stitching is done manually by a real person but the leather is cut in batches same as the misticaudio case. Additionally, if you look around on the internet you'll find complaints about the Noreve case just like any other, not fitting properly, button holes not lining up properly, etc.
It's a very long story but here it is in short....
A company called Innovacases (some of you remember) was the European distributor for Vaja. They decided to start producing their own product under the Noreve name and were able to get a good sum of publicity by alluding that their product was made by Vaja for them and of the same quality but less expensive. This went on for some time and then Vaja pulled the plug on allowing Innovacases to sell Vaja. Now Innovacases is no more, fully merged into Noreve.
As for the quality of the two here... Without looking at packaging and logo'd materials you'd be hard pressed to tell the difference... I don't believe in fancy packaging that gets thrown away.. also don't believe in logo'd linings that do nothing but look nice as all that translates into cost which has to be passed onto the consumer, not to mention the fact that the lining is the least visible part of the case.
